Are people in St. Louis Park older or younger than people in Falcon Heights?
- The Median Age in St. Louis Park is 1.8 years older than in Falcon Heights.

Are housing costs cheaper in St. Louis Park or Falcon Heights?
- St. Louis Park housing costs are 4.6% less expensive than Falcon Heights hous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, St. Louis Park or Falcon Heights?
- The average commute for residents of St. Louis Park is 0.7 minutes longer than it is for residents of Falcon Heights.

Things to do in St. Louis Park?
St Louis Park, MN is a vibrant community located in Hennepin County near Minneapolis. Home to multiple parks & recreational areas including Aquila Park & the Minneapolis Chain of Lakes Trail Network , St Louis Park provides its residents with plenty of outdoor resources perfect for activities like biking along Cedar Lake LRT Regional Trail or taking a stroll through Wolfe's Grove off-leash DogPark . The area also features numerous dining options , unique shops , entertainment venues , art galleries & other amenities that make living here so enjoyable . With its close proximity to both Minneapolis& St Paul , St Louis Park provides an ideal balance between urban & suburban life !
